Leios Was First Introduced in November 2022 As a New Family Variant of Cardano’s Ouroboros Consensus Protocol. At the Time, iog Highlightd that existing Design Such as Praos and Genesis Faced Fundamental Scalacy Limits – Not Due to Bandwidth or Cpu, But Due to Algorithmic DependenCies Thra. Leios Seeks to Address Tese Limits with a major Architectural Overhaul, Including Faster Chain Sync, Tiered Transaction Fees, and Greater Service Prioritization.
The Upgrade Is Not Just A Tweak to the Existing System But A Substantial Redesign. While Implementation Will Demand Considerable Changes, ITS Benefits Could Be Transformational. Iog co-funer and ceo charles hoskinson said on x on x on may 10 that expects leios to go live on the Cardano Mainnet in 2026, A Timeline That Was Reportedly Accelerated.
